收藏
回答

urlscheme.generate query一旦传入=和&就报错,为何不能传=和&?

urlscheme.generate中query 为何不能传=和&,一旦传这两个字符就会报40212query错误,但如果我把query的内容转义了,不会报错,但是不会跳转到我想要的页面。

完整路径:(举例)

/pages/index/index?type=webview&data=https%3A%2F%2Fwww.baidu.com%2FvuePage%2Findex.html%23%2Fapprove%2Fhome


path:/pages/index/index

query:type=webview&data=https%3A%2F%2Fwww.baidu.com%2FvuePage%2Findex.html%23%2Fapprove%2Fhome

以上传过去会报40212

经过encodeURIComponent(query)转义后,不会跳转到我想跳转的页面。

转义后的qurey:type%3Dwebview%26data%3Dhttps%253A%252F%252Fapp.feparks.com%252FvuePage%252Findex.html%2523%252Fapprove%252Fhome

我觉得是query的问题,但是又不知道query怎么传才正确。请大佬们帮我看看谢谢~


最后一次编辑于  2022-06-14
回答关注问题邀请回答
收藏

2 个回答

  • Demons
    Demons
    2022-06-14

    2022-06-14
    有用
    回复
  • s.
    s.
    2022-07-14

    你好 你的报错信息从哪里看到的

    2022-07-14
    有用
    回复 1
    • s.
      s.
      2022-07-14
      解决了吗?
      2022-07-14
      回复
登录 后发表内容